The Construction Productivity Problem Behind Drywall Demand

A construction project can lose substantial time when interior work becomes a bottleneck. Walls, ceilings, finishing, electrical systems, insulation, and final fixtures all have to move through a tightly coordinated sequence. That makes material selection a productivity decision, not simply a design choice. The Drywall and Gypsum Board Industry reached USD 35.79 billion in 2025 after being valued at USD 33.78 billion in 2024 and is projected to reach USD 63.8 billion by 2035, representing a 5.95% CAGR during 2025-2035. The underlying opportunity comes from construction's continuing search for faster installation, reliable quality, adaptable interiors, and more sustainable building practices.

What Is Creating New Demand

The most important demand driver is the continued need for efficient interior construction.

Housing development generates large volumes of wallboard and ceiling-board requirements, but the market extends well beyond new homes. Renovation projects, commercial refurbishments, institutional upgrades, hospitality projects, and office modernization can all require extensive interior wall and ceiling work.

That matters because construction demand is rarely uniform. New-building cycles can slow, while renovation continues. A product category that serves both activities has greater resilience than one tied exclusively to a single project type.

Urbanization adds another dimension. As cities expand and existing urban areas are redeveloped, builders need interior systems that can be installed efficiently across apartments, offices, retail spaces, and public facilities.

The resulting demand is not simply for more boards. It is for materials that fit increasingly compressed project schedules.

The Real Value of Wall and Ceiling Systems

The economics of drywall become clearer when construction is viewed as a sequence of interconnected activities.

A material that installs efficiently can help contractors coordinate multiple trades. A predictable board dimension can simplify planning and cutting. A system that produces a consistent finish can reduce rework. A product designed for specific conditions can prevent performance problems later.

These advantages can influence total project economics even when the board itself represents only one part of construction expenditure.

Wallboard serves broad partitioning and interior-wall applications. Ceiling boards support overhead systems, while pre-decorated boards can reduce some finishing requirements. The segmentation therefore reflects different approaches to solving the same fundamental problem: how to create functional, finished interiors with greater control over time and labor.

Renovation Could Become as Important as New Construction

New construction often receives the greatest attention, but renovation creates a different and potentially more stable source of demand.

Existing buildings regularly require changes to room configurations, interior finishes, ceiling systems, commercial layouts, and residential spaces. Property owners may also modernize buildings to improve appearance, functionality, or marketability.

Drywall systems are suited to these changes because interior partitions can be altered without requiring the same degree of structural intervention associated with major rebuilding.

This makes refurbishment particularly relevant in mature construction markets. Rather than depending entirely on population growth or new housing supply, manufacturers can participate in an ongoing cycle of property renewal.

Sustainability Is Becoming an Economic Question

Sustainability in gypsum-board manufacturing cannot be reduced to the use of a single environmentally preferable input.

The larger issue is resource efficiency across production, transportation, installation, and disposal. Manufacturing energy consumption matters. Waste generation matters. The ability to recover or recycle material matters. Transportation efficiency matters because boards must move from factories to construction sites.

For manufacturers, sustainability can therefore become an operational challenge as well as a product-marketing issue.

The strongest approach is likely to involve incremental improvements across the value chain. Reducing production waste, improving logistics, developing more efficient manufacturing processes, and supporting responsible end-of-life management can collectively improve the material's lifecycle profile.

For contractors and developers, the value lies in balancing environmental goals with project cost, availability, performance, and installation requirements.

Technology Is Changing the Factory Before It Changes the Job Site

Manufacturing automation can play an important role in improving product consistency and operational efficiency.

Gypsum-board production requires controlled processes to maintain uniformity and quality. Greater automation can help manufacturers monitor production variables, improve throughput, and reduce avoidable material losses.

The benefits extend into construction. Consistent products make installation and finishing more predictable. Better product engineering can also create boards suited to particular environments or project requirements.

Pre-decorated products illustrate another direction. Moving more finishing work into manufacturing can reduce the amount of labor required after delivery. That becomes commercially attractive when contractors face tight schedules or limited skilled labor.

The next stage of development is therefore less about inventing an entirely new wall material and more about making the existing system easier to manufacture, transport, install, and finish.

Regional Growth Has Different Foundations

Regional demand should be viewed through local construction economics rather than through a simple ranking.

North America benefits from an established drywall construction culture and a substantial renovation market. Replacement, remodeling, commercial refurbishment, and new construction all contribute to demand.

Europe presents a different mix. Building modernization, renovation, sustainability expectations, and construction efficiency are important considerations. In many projects, the material's lifecycle characteristics can become part of the purchasing decision.

Asia-Pacific has a strong growth opportunity because urbanization and infrastructure development continue to create new residential and commercial construction requirements. Greater adoption of standardized construction systems can further support demand.

Other regions can benefit from expanding construction activity and modernization of building practices. The pace will depend heavily on investment conditions, local construction methods, supply availability, and economic development.

Competitive Dynamics Are About More Than Manufacturing Volume

The market includes established companies such as USG Corporation, Knauf Gips KG, Saint-Gobain, National Gypsum Company, Georgia-Pacific LLC, and CertainTeed Corporation.

Their competitive relevance comes from the combination of manufacturing capability, distribution networks, product portfolios, technical knowledge, and relationships with construction professionals.

Scale is particularly useful in a material category where transportation and availability influence purchasing decisions. Contractors need products to arrive when projects require them, making regional manufacturing and distribution capabilities commercially significant.

Yet scale alone does not solve every market challenge. Manufacturers also need to respond to changing building practices and sustainability expectations. Product development aimed at easier installation, specialized performance, and reduced environmental impact can provide differentiation in markets where conventional boards are widely available.

The Opportunity in Specialized Construction

One of the more interesting opportunities lies in moving beyond the idea of drywall as a standardized commodity.

Different construction environments create different requirements. Residential renovation may prioritize ease of installation and appearance. Commercial projects may emphasize schedule control and finishing quality. Institutional or specialized buildings can place greater importance on performance and durability.

This creates room for manufacturers to develop differentiated systems rather than relying entirely on standard products.

Digital planning and increasingly coordinated construction workflows could also support this trend. As builders move toward more controlled project planning, materials that integrate smoothly into standardized installation systems may gain an advantage.

Risks That Could Slow Adoption

The market still faces several constraints.

Construction downturns can reduce new-building activity quickly. Higher transportation and energy costs can pressure margins. Labor shortages can limit the productivity gains that materials are designed to provide. Alternative wall systems can compete where their structural, aesthetic, or performance characteristics better match a project.

Supply-chain disruptions can also matter because drywall is a high-volume construction material. A local shortage can delay projects even when overall global supply appears adequate.

Sustainability requirements may introduce additional investment needs. Manufacturers that cannot adapt production processes or demonstrate stronger lifecycle performance could face pressure from customers and regulators.
